About Structural Chemistry
The NIBR Emeryville Structural Chemistry group is responsible for actively
pursuing protein-ligand interaction studies using NMR spectroscopy, X-ray
crystallography, and complementary biophysical methods to support drug
discovery projects. The group also determines the structures of macromolecular
drug targets either as apo-proteins or in complex with lead compounds to help
guide structure-based drug design, and actively participates in the drug
discovery process.
We are seeking a multifaceted individual with a strong scientific background
and relevant expertise in the use of surface plasmon resonance (SPR) and other
biophysical methods, such as isothermal calorimetry, to discover small molecule
inhibitors and activators of drug targets, particularly in the context of
fragment-based lead discovery.
